Tulane star running back Makhi Hughes is entering the transfer portal, ESPN reported Friday.
A two-time selection to the All-American Athletic Conference first-team, Hughes has two years of eligibility remaining.
Hughes rushed for 1,401 yards and 15 touchdowns in 14 games for the Green Wave (9-5) this season.
He was named the AAC Rookie of the Year in 2023 with 1,378 rushing yards and seven touchdowns.
The Birmingham, Ala., native was a three-star recruit in the Class of 2022, as ranked by 247Sports.
